Mr. Michael Thomson is the founder and a director of Design Connect in UK. He has been currently active in British design field as a design facilitator and other positions to promote design. He had been at the position of a board member of the International Council of Societies of Industrial Design from the year 2001 through 2005.
Mr. Thomson had visited Japan as a design ambassador requested by Japan Institute of Design Promotion (JDP). Together with GK’s request to him for a speech at GK about recent European design and his own will to visit GK made the session possible. The speech was about the current situation of European design, centered by a practical case of European Commission’s try, to adopt an effective design policy.

Mr. Michael Thomson:

The founder and a director of Design Connect (1995) in UK.
He has been working since the establishment of Design Connect in British design field as a designer, a facilitator, a strategist for many international clients such as Tupperware, Dyson, Samsung and so on.
He also has been active in cooperation, as a specialist of a national design policy, with many design promotional entities from different regions and nations such as UK, Asia, Australia, Iceland, Ireland, Italy and Katal. He has been leading the adoption of a design policy as an important governmental issue for European Commission. As a result, Mr. Thomson had succeeded in making the Bureau of European Design Associations (BEDA) to have management- autonomy to include design in the innovation strategy first time in Europe in 2010.
Had been the representative of BEDA from 2007 through 2009.
Also, responsible as a board member of ICSID from 2001 to 2005.
